Diane Moseley Angel, daughter of the late Martha P. Hall and late Harley Moseley, was born on August 22, 1947, in Chattanooga, Tennessee.

She graduated from East Ridge High School and attended East Tennessee State University. At an early age she professed her faith in Jesus Christ and walked through Him throughout her life.

Diane was retired from the Hamilton County Sheriff’s Department where she worked in the Finance Department. She spent her free time having lunch with her lady friends from childhood, including her best friend Diane Clements, enjoyed beloved time spent with her grandchildren, and riding around town listening to her Elvis CDs.

She went to be with her Savior on Monday, July 25, 2022, at the age of 74. Her beautiful life will forever be cherished by the lives of her son, Curtis Angel, daughter-in-law Angela Angel, grandchildren: Braxton, Katelyn, and Austin, and brothers David Moseley (late) and Daniel Moseley, both from the Nashville area.  As well as, a host of cherished n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.

There will be a Celebration of Life Ceremony with close family in the Nashville area at an upcoming date.

Arrangements are by Cremation Center of Chattanooga, 1345 Hickory Valley Road, Chattanooga, Tn. 37421, 423-362-5999.
